[csw-devel] SF.net SVN: gar:[21526] csw/mgar/pkg/ImageMagick/trunk
lblume at users.sourceforge.net
lblume at users.sourceforge.net
Thu Jul 18 16:13:45 CEST 2013
Revision: 21526
http://gar.svn.sourceforge.net/gar/?rev=21526&view=rev
Author: lblume
Date: 2013-07-18 14:13:44 +0000 (Thu, 18 Jul 2013)
Log Message:
-----------
ImageMagick/trunk: Bump revision to -6; Switch compiler to GCC; disable Perl as it is not GCC compatible
Modified Paths:
--------------
csw/mgar/pkg/ImageMagick/trunk/Makefile
csw/mgar/pkg/ImageMagick/trunk/checksums
Modified: csw/mgar/pkg/ImageMagick/trunk/Makefile
===================================================================
--- csw/mgar/pkg/ImageMagick/trunk/Makefile 2013-07-18 13:10:30 UTC (rev 21525)
+++ csw/mgar/pkg/ImageMagick/trunk/Makefile 2013-07-18 14:13:44 UTC (rev 21526)
@@ -1,6 +1,6 @@
NAME = imagemagick
VERSION = 6.8.6
-GARSUBREV = 5
+GARSUBREV = 6
GARTYPE = v2
DESCRIPTION = A comprehensive package supporting automated and interative manipulation of images
@@ -53,26 +53,27 @@
R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ibfreetype6
R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ibfontconfig1
R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ibfftw3-3
-R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ibglib2-0-0
+R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ibgomp1
+RUNTIME_DEP_PKGS_CSWlibmagickcore6q16hdri1 += CSWlibgcc-s1
-# For some reason, on sparc only, this gets linked against glib2
-# Override is for x86 only
-CHECKPKG_OVERRIDES_CSWlibmagickcore6q16hdri1 += surplus-dependency|CSWlibglib2-0-0
-
PACKAGES += CSWlibmagickwand6q16hdri1
CATALOGNAME_CSWlibmagickwand6q16hdri1 = libmagickwand6q16hdri1
SPKG_DESC_CSWlibmagickwand6q16hdri1 += Library from ImageMagick, libMagickWand-6.Q16HDRI.so.1
PKGFILES_CSWlibmagickwand6q16hdri1 += $(call baseisadirs,$(libdir),libMagickWand-6\.Q16HDRI\.so\.1\.0\.0)
PKGFILES_CSWlibmagickwand6q16hdri1 += $(call baseisadirs,$(libdir),libMagickWand-6\.Q16HDRI\.so\.1(\.\d+)*)
RUNTIME_DEP_PKGS_CSWlibmagickwand6q16hdri1 += CSWlibmagickcore6q16hdri1
+RUNTIME_DEP_PKGS_CSWlibmagickwand6q16hdri1 += CSWlibgomp1
+RUNTIME_DEP_PKGS_CSWlibmagickwand6q16hdri1 += CSWlibgcc-s1
-PACKAGES += CSWlibmagick++6q16hdri1
-CATALOGNAME_CSWlibmagick++6q16hdri1 = libmagick++6q16hdri1
-PKGFILES_CSWlibmagick++6q16hdri1 += $(call baseisadirs,$(libdir),libMagick\+\+-6\.Q16HDRI\.so\.1\.0\.0)
-PKGFILES_CSWlibmagick++6q16hdri1 += $(call baseisadirs,$(libdir),libMagick\+\+-6\.Q16HDRI\.so\.1(\.\d+)*)
-SPKG_DESC_CSWlibmagick++6q16hdri1 += Library from ImageMagick, libMagick++-6.Q16HDRI.so.1
-R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ri1 += CSWlibmagickcore6q16hdri1
-R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ri1 += CSWlibmagickwand6q16hdri1
+PACKAGES += CSWlibmagick++6q16hdri2
+CATALOGNAME_CSWlibmagick++6q16hdri2 = libmagick++6q16hdri2
+PKGFILES_CSWlibmagick++6q16hdri2 += $(call baseisadirs,$(libdir),libMagick\+\+-6\.Q16HDRI\.so\.2\.0\.0)
+PKGFILES_CSWlibmagick++6q16hdri2 += $(call baseisadirs,$(libdir),libMagick\+\+-6\.Q16HDRI\.so\.2(\.\d+)*)
+SPKG_DESC_CSWlibmagick++6q16hdri2 += Library from ImageMagick, libMagick++-6.Q16HDRI.so.2
+R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ri2 += CSWlibmagickcore6q16hdri1
+R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ri2 += CSWlibmagickwand6q16hdri1
+R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ri2 += CSWlibgcc-s1
+RUNTIME_DEP_PKGS_CSWlibmagick++6q16hdri2 += CSWlibstdc++6
PACKAGES += CSWimagemagick-dev
SPKG_DESC_CSWimagemagick-dev = Development files for ImageMagick libraries
@@ -83,7 +84,7 @@
R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Wimagemagick
R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Wlibmagickcore6q16hdri1
R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Wlibmagickwand6q16hdri1
-R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Wlibmagick++6q16hdri1
+R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Wlibmagick++6q16hdri2
RUNTIME_DEP_PKGS_CSWimagemagick-dev += CSWperl
PACKAGES += CSWimagemagick
@@ -110,21 +111,22 @@
RUNTIME_DEP_PKGS_CSWimagemagick += CSWlibjasper1
RUNTIME_DEP_PKGS_CSWimagemagick += CSWlibglib2-0-0
RUNTIME_DEP_PKGS_CSWimagemagick += CSWlibrsvg2-2
+RUNTIME_DEP_PKGS_CSWimagemagick += CSWlibgcc-s1
-PACKAGES += CSWpm-image-magick
-SPKG_DESC_CSWpm-image-magick = Image::Magick: Perl binding for Imagemagick
-PKGFILES_CSWpm-image-magick += $(libdir)/perl/.*
-PKGFILES_CSWpm-image-magick += $(mandir)/.*\.3perl
+#PACKAGES += CSWpm-image-magick
+#SPKG_DESC_CSWpm-image-magick = Image::Magick: Perl binding for Imagemagick
+#PKGFILES_CSWpm-image-magick += $(libdir)/perl/.*
+#PKGFILES_CSWpm-image-magick += $(mandir)/.*\.3perl
-RUNTIME_DEP_PKGS_CSWpm-image-magick += CSWperl
-RUNTIME_DEP_PKGS_CSWpm-image-magick += CSWlibmagickcore6q16hdri1
+#RUNTIME_DEP_PKGS_CSWpm-image-magick += CSWperl
+#RUNTIME_DEP_PKGS_CSWpm-image-magick += CSWlibmagickcore6q16hdri1
# No binary in that package, since no 64 bit perl
-CHECKPKG_OVERRIDES_CSWpm-image-magick += 64-bit-binaries-missing
+#CHECKPKG_OVERRIDES_CSWpm-image-magick += 64-bit-binaries-missing
REINPLACE_USRLOCAL += config/mime.xml
-EXTRA_LINKER_FLAGS = -lsocket -lnsl
+EXTRA_LINKER_FLAGS = -Bdirect -lsocket -lnsl
EXTRA_LD_OPTIONS = -z nolazyload
# We especially don't want ISALIST for the above /usr/openwin/lib
@@ -148,10 +150,12 @@
CONFIGURE_ARGS += --with-wmf
CONFIGURE_ARGS += --with-rsvg
+# Disable perl completely for now
+CONFIGURE_ARGS += --without-perl
# Until graphviz and perl is 64bit
+CONFIGURE_ARGS-64 += --without-gvc
#CONFIGURE_ARGS-32 += --with-perl=$(bindir)/perl
-CONFIGURE_ARGS-64 += --without-gvc
-CONFIGURE_ARGS += --without-perl
+#CONFIGURE_ARGS-64 += --without-perl
CONFIGURE_ARGS += $(CONFIGURE_ARGS-$(MEMORYMODEL))
# One test is failing:
Modified: csw/mgar/pkg/ImageMagick/trunk/checksums
===================================================================
--- csw/mgar/pkg/ImageMagick/trunk/checksums 2013-07-18 13:10:30 UTC (rev 21525)
+++ csw/mgar/pkg/ImageMagick/trunk/checksums 2013-07-18 14:13:44 UTC (rev 21526)
@@ -1 +1 @@
-ee6e195d18012fb6b2bd82634ea51fd1 ImageMagick-6.8.6-5.tar.xz
+ddd46cdf8f6eb22deee14d4fee267796 ImageMagick-6.8.6-6.tar.xz
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
More information about the devel
mailing list